I make at least two wreaths every year to put inside my home, and one big one for the front door.  I normally go out after Christmas and rack up and get tons of stuff for decorating, so I won't break my pockets during the Christmas Season!!

 So the wreath I used, I made last year and had it over my fireplace,  but I decided to recycle it and just add new colors... The original colors I used where red and silver, and I wanted to keep the silver and just now do pink and silver. So I just took out the red and added pink!!!! So guys basically what I started out with was a plain Jane old wreath, which I got two years ago after Christmas for 4.99 on clearance!! It is huge!! I Love it, and I have a couple of them..LOL  I then went to Hobby Lobby (or you can go to Michaels) and just buy the little pieces they sell that you can stick on your Christmas tree for decoration.. (they have tons AFTER Christmas on clearance) Most of them come already in a decorative bundle so you can just add it to your wreath!! You will also need a glue gun and glue sticks. Most of the decorative bundles I brought were between 10 cents to 40 cents, 80 to 90% off!!!!  Then just glue, glue, glue until you get the look you are looking for. As far as the bow, I just took some Christmas ribbon and made my bow!!!   Check out the pics below, and just email me if you have any questions!! Don't pay all those sky high prices for a wreath!! :) Make your own FABULOUS wreath for Christmas!!!  It's SO SO easy!!
